Always go out of your way to tip any bell station and housekeeper appropriately. An appropriate tip is considered $1 for each piece of luggage you have, and $2-$5 per day for the housekeeping service. If you tip well, you are more likely to get good service and be on good terms with hotel staff during your stay.

Be cautious when traveling to foreign destinations. Criminals may pose as government or police officials. Never give them your original passport as you may never see it again. If they want you to come with them to a police station, make sure that you walk there. Avoid getting into a vehicle with anyone you don’t know.

If you utilize a public computer when traveling, avoid using it to do any financial work, such as doing banking or checking the balance on your credit card. Public computers sometimes have keyloggers in them, so when you access your accounts, the person who installed the keylogger can also access your accout.

If you come through a little airport when you travel, look at their website to see what services the airline offers. Charter airlines often operate out of smaller airports; their rates, which may be cheaper than those of the bigger airlines, do not always appear when you do a rate search.

Be sure to put identification information inside your luggage in addition to the normal luggage tag. A tag hanging from your luggage may easily fall off during transit. Should it be that your bags go missing and no tag is attached, airline employees will look for identification you have placed inside so that they can get your bags to you.

If you are traveling by vehicle, plan your road travel to miss rush hour in any city you will be in. If you are unable to plan a trip that avoids rush hour, use this time to take a break. This can be a great time to relax and get a bite to eat, or maybe let the kids out to burn off some energy.

If you plan on visiting the National Parks often, it would be best to invest in a National Park Pass. It is relatively inexpensive, $50 total, and it gives you open access to all national parks for a year.

Make sure you are careful about any food allergies you may have whenever you visit a foreign land. If your food allergy is particularly bad, make sure to express this in their language. You can use this fluency to inform people of your allergies, and, if needed, describe them to medical personnel.
